What Happened

Google has announced a significant change in its approach to Chrome browser updates. Starting soon, Chrome will receive updates every two weeks instead of the previous monthly schedule. This decision comes in response to the rapidly evolving landscape of cybersecurity threats?, where vulnerabilities? can be exploited in a matter of days.

The tech giant aims to enhance user security by addressing potential threats more swiftly. With cyberattacks becoming more sophisticated, Google recognizes that a faster update cycle? is essential to protect users from emerging vulnerabilities?. This proactive approach reflects their commitment to maintaining a secure browsing experience for millions of users worldwide.
